A protocol for in vitro multiplication of red rose (Rosa bourboniania) was developed. Multiple shoots were induced from nodal segments and shoot tips. MS (Murashige and Skoog) medium supplemented with various combinations of BAP (6-Benzyl Amino Purine), NAA (1-Naphthylene Acetic Acid), IAA ( Indole Acetic Acid) were used to study the in vitro growth response. Culture initiation media were used for further multiplication. MS medium incorporated with 2.0 mgl-1 BAP, 30 mgl-1, Ad.SO4 (Adenine sulphate) and 3% sucrose was found to be the most suitable medium for culture initiation and multiplication. Growth regulator combinations did not seem to influence multiple shooting and further growth in this species.
